With From Software possibly putting most of their attention towards the 2015 PlayStation 4 exclusive action RPG Bloodborne, one could question if or when another Dark Souls game will be released. While that is still up in the air, there is still a DLC trilogy for Dark Souls II to go yet – with each release set to provide even more challenging dungeons and boss fights.
The first of these DLC chapters, Crown of the Sunken King, has today been launched on the PlayStation Store, Xbox Live Marketplace and Steam and now available for purchase. Players that are brave enough to take on this arduous journey will find new environments, enemies, traps, and bosses to conquer as they embark on a journey to reclaim the crowns that Drangleic’s King Vendrick once owned. Crown of the Sunken King features an entirely different world within the Dark Souls II universe, where stepped pyramids span a vast underground cavern and death lays in wait around every corner.
